Minn. Stat. § 365.07: TO PAY OFFICERS AND EXPENSES; TO RAISE MONEY.

It is a town charge:

(1) to pay town officers for services performed for the town;

(2) to pay contingent expenses necessarily incurred for the use and benefit of the town;

(3) to raise money authorized to be raised by the vote of the town meeting for general purposes; and

(4) to raise money directed by law to be raised for any town purpose.
